-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
分布式系统在云测试中的应用研究
目录
心M.L咖s
第一部分分布式系统定义 2
第二部分云测试概念 4
第三部分分布式系统在云测试中的作用 7
第四部分关键技术与实现方法 11
第五部分案例分析与实践效果 15
第六部分挑战与未来趋势 18
第七部分安全性问题探讨 21
第八部分总结与展望 26
第一部分分布式系统定义
关键词
关键要点
分布式系统定义
1.分布式系统是一种由多个独立或协同工作的计算机、网络设备、数据库和其他资源组成的系统,它们通过网络连接并共同完成一个任务或服务。
2.分布式系统通过分布式计算和分布式存储技术实现资源的共享和服务的分布处理,以提高系统的可扩展性、容错性和性能。
3.分布式系统通常包括分布式协调机制、数据一致性和并发控制等关键技术,以确保系统中各节点之间的通信和协作能够顺利进行。
分布式系统的优势
1.提高系统可靠性:分布式系统通过冗余设计,可以有效减少单点故障的影响,提高整个系统的可靠性。
2.增强系统可扩展性:分布式系统可以通过增加更多的节点来扩展系统容量,满足不断增长的业务需求。
3.提高系统性能:分布式系统通过负载均衡和并行处理技术,可以有效地分配和利用资源,提高系统的整体性能。
分布式系统的应用领域
1.云计算:分布式系统是云计算的基础架构之一,通过将应用程序和服务部署在多个服务器上,实现了高可用性和弹性伸缩。
2.大数据处理:分布式系统适用于处理大规模数据集,通过分布式计算和分布式存储技术,提高了数据处理的效率和准确性。
3.人工智能:分布式系统支持并行计算和分布式训练,为人工智能模型的训练和应用提供了强大的支撑。
分布式系统面临的挑战
1.系统稳定性和可靠性:分布式系统需要确保各个节点之间的通信和协作能够顺利进行,避免出现数据不一致或服务中断的情况。
2.数据一致性和同步:分布式系统中的数据需要保持一致性和同步性,否则可能导致数据丢失或错误。
3.性能优化和资源管理:分布式系统需要高效地管理和调度资源,以应对不同的业务场景和需求。
分布式系统定义
分布式系统是一种由多个独立的计算机或网络节点组成的复杂系统,这些节点在逻辑上共享资源和数据,并协同工作以完成特定的任务。它们通常具有以下特点:
1.去中心化:分布式系统没有单一的控制中心,而是将计算和数据处理任务分散到多个节点上,以实现更高效的资源利用和容错能力。
2.资源共享:分布式系统中的每个节点都可以访问共享的资源,如文件、数据库、网络等。这些资源可以是物理设备(如服务器、存储设备)或软件资源(如操作系统、应用程序)。
3.并行处理:分布式系统允许多个节点同时执行相同的任务,从而提高整体的处理速度和效率。这种并行处理能力使得分布式系统能够应对大量请求和高负载情况。
4.容错性:分布式系统通过冗余设计和故障恢复机制来确保其可靠性和稳定性。当某个节点出现故障时,其他节点可以接管其功能,从而保持系统的正常运行。
5.可扩展性:分布式系统可以根据需求灵活地添加或删除节点,以适应不断变化的环境。这种可扩展性使得分布式系统能够更好地适应
新的应用场景和技术发展。
6.通信与协作:分布式系统中的节点需要通过有效的通信协议进行数据传输和信息交换。这些协议可以包括同步、异步、消息传递等不同类型的通信方式。节点之间还需要协作完成任务,这可能涉及数据共享、任务分配、结果合并等操作。
总之,分布式系统是一种高度复杂的计算和数据处理架构,它通过将任务分散到多个节点上并利用这些节点的并行处理能力来实现更高的效率和可靠性。随着云计算和大数据技术的发展,分布式系统在云测试中的应用变得越来越重要,它可以为云服务提供商提供更好的性能保障和服务质量。
第二部分云测试概念
关键词
关键要点
云测试的概念与目标
1.云测试是一种基于云计算技术的系统测试方法,旨在通过虚拟化、自动化和远程管理等手段提高测试效率和质量。
2.云测试的核心目标是实现快速部署、灵活配置和高效协作,以应对不断变化的测试环境和需求。
3.云测试能够支持大规模并发测试,确保软件系统的高可用性和稳定性。
云测试的优势与挑战
1.优势包括降低成本、提升效率、增强灵活性和可扩展性等,特别是在资源受限的环境中。
2.挑战则涉及技术复杂性、数据安全与隐私保护、跨地域协作等方面,需要不断优化和改进。
云测试的实施过程
1.云测试通常包括环境搭建、测试设计、执行监控和结果分析四个阶段。
2.在环境搭建阶段,需要选择合适的云平台和工具,建立所需的测试环境。
3.测试设计阶段,需明确测试目标、制定测试计划并设计测试用例。
4.执行监控阶段,实
您可能关注的文档
- 凤台县公费师范生招聘真题2025.docx
- 凤台县公费师范生招聘真题2025.pdf
- 出院带药的规范指南2026.pdf
- 创新公共就业服务场景支持多元劳动力就业研究.pdf
- 利润与净收益的深度剖析.pdf
- 前列腺癌骨转移诊疗2026.pdf
- 加密交易中的心理因素分析-剖析洞察.docx
- 加密交易中的心理因素分析-剖析洞察.pdf
- 动态数字孪生模型驱动的施工安全预警技术.pdf
- 动静脉内瘘穿刺的综合评估2026.pdf
- 煤矿运输专业培训课件.ppt
- 2026年中考语文一轮复习:语言基础+课件.pptx
- 辽宁《岩土工程勘察规程》.pdf
- 统编版道德与法治三年级下册4.13万里一线牵 第二课时 课件 (共24张PPT).pptx
- 统编版七年级语文上册教学课件《狼》.pptx
- 习作 这儿真美 课件-2025-2026学年语文三年级上册统编版.pptx
- 统编版五年级上册习作 我想对您说 优质课件(共52张PPT).pptx
- 统编版语文八年级上册第四单元整本书阅读《红岩》 课件(共37张PPT).pptx
- 湘教版(2024)地理 八年级上册 第一章第二节 中国的行政区划 课件(19张PPT).pptx
- 细胞通过分裂产生新细胞课件2025-2026学年人教版生物七年级上册.pptx
原创力文档


文档评论(0)